当前位置: 代码迷 >> Eclipse >> 新老编码转换遗留有关问题
  详细解决方案

新老编码转换遗留有关问题

热度:53   发布时间:2016-04-23 00:24:44.0
新老编码转换遗留问题
以前代码是用GBK编码的,后面转换成UTF-8,结果经过各种平台上编译运行测试后变成了

......
请问各位大神有什么解决方法,还原的方法
------解决思路----------------------
引用:
Quote: 引用:

看具体情况, 有可能可以还原有可能无法还原

那怎么看能不能,我这个能吗?

首先你乱码的这个内容是啥, 是你的代码吗, 是你代码里的注释吗, 是你代码读取出来的数据吗, 然后你开始是gbk,然后改成utf8, 这个过程是怎样的, 是直接在ide里改文件属性吗, 如果是这样那你改完之后的中文肯定是乱码的, 那么这个阶段的乱码你还有处理过吗, 如果你不是直接在ide里改文件属性, 而是拷贝的代码文本到新的utf8格式的文件中, 那么这个阶段你的代码就是utf8的并且不乱码的, 那么接下来你说在各种平台编译运行又是什么意思, 所以我说有可能能, 有可能不能, 你描述的太简单了, 具体情况具体分析
------解决思路----------------------
引用:
Quote: 引用:

看具体情况, 有可能可以还原有可能无法还原

那怎么看能不能,我这个能吗?

我始终认为不把问题分析清楚然后给到结论给提问者, 是非常不负责任的行为, 你的这个问题所有直接回答能或者不能的, 在我眼中都是不负责任的行为, 根据乱码形成原理, 你这个有可能可以恢复, 也有可能不能恢复
  相关解决方案